云服务器装系统教学反思(云服务器安装操作系统)
### 云服务器装系统教学反思(云服务器安装操作系统) #### 一、引言:从"安装步骤"到"系统思维"的教学重构 在云计算技术普及的当下,云服务器已成为企业数字化转型和开发者实践的核心基础设施。无论是搭建网站、部署应用还是运行大数据分析,操作系统作为云服务器的"灵魂",其安装质量直接决定后续服务稳定性、安全性和扩展性。然而,在过往的教学实践中,我发现多数学员对"云服务器装系统"的认知仍停留在"按教程点击下一步"的表层操作,忽视了硬件虚拟化特性、镜像生态适配、网络环境配置等底层逻辑。这种"重步骤、轻原理"的教学模式,导致学员在实际场景中频繁遭遇启动失败、性能瓶颈、安全漏洞等问题。 教学反思的本质,是跳出"教会操作"的表层目标,转向"培养系统思维"的深层能力。云服务器安装操作系统绝非孤立的技术环节,而是涉及硬件资源调度(CPU/内存/存储配置)、虚拟化技术选型(KVM/VMware/容器引擎)、系统版本兼容性(Linux内核优化/Windows Server补丁管理)、网络安全策略(安全组/访问控制列表)等多维度的综合实践。例如,某电商企业学员在迁移Windows Server 2019系统时,因未考虑云服务商的"热迁移"限制,导致数据同步中断;某高校实验室学员因忽视镜像源选择,误装CentOS Stream版本导致Docker服务无法启动——这些案例均暴露出传统教学在技术深度和场景适配性上的缺失。 #### 二、教学目标偏差:被忽视的"操作系统全生命周期认知" 传统教学中,"云服务器装系统"的目标常被简化为"完成镜像部署+远程连接成功",这种片面的目标设定直接导致学员陷入"知其然,不知其所以然"的困境。深入反思后发现,教学中存在三个核心认知偏差: **1. 镜像选择的盲目性** 云服务商提供的操作系统镜像包含基础版、企业版、定制版等多种类型,如阿里云的"CentOS 7.9-minimal"与"Ubuntu 22.04-server"在包管理器、服务启停命令、性能调优参数上差异显著。但学员常因"教程推荐"或"个人习惯"直接选择镜像,忽视应用场景匹配性。例如,某金融学员为部署Windows Server 2016系统,因未注意云服务器内存仅2GB,导致系统频繁报"内存不足"错误;某教育机构学员误将"Windows Server 2012 R2"用于部署Java Web应用,因版本过旧导致依赖库缺失。 **2. 硬件配置与系统需求的脱节** 云服务器的"虚拟硬件"特性(如CPU核心数、内存规格、存储类型)与操作系统存在强关联性。教学中常出现学员照搬本地服务器安装经验,忽视云平台的资源限制:如将4核8G配置的云服务器安装为64位Windows Server 2022,未意识到其镜像对内存和CPU调度的特殊要求;或在轻量应用服务器(LTS)上强行安装Docker Desktop,导致容器运行时资源冲突。这些问题的根源在于教学中对"云环境硬件抽象层"的讲解不足,学员无法理解"云服务器本质是共享物理资源的虚拟化实例"这一核心特性。 **3. 安全配置的后知后觉** 安装完成后,学员往往直接进入业务部署环节,忽视操作系统的安全加固:如使用默认管理员账户(如root或Administrator)未修改密码、开放不必要的端口(如22端口对Linux的远程登录)、未配置云服务商的安全组规则等。某学员曾因在云服务器上直接使用"yum install"安装软件,导致CentOS系统被恶意包注入,服务器沦为挖矿节点——这反映出教学中"重部署、轻安全"的倾向,未能将"最小权限原则""边界防护"等安全思维融入系统安装环节。 #### 三、技术难点解析:云服务器安装中的常见教学痛点 在教学过程中,云服务器安装操作系统的技术难点可归纳为三类,每类难点对应不同的教学痛点: **1. 虚拟化层与镜像适配的认知断层** 云服务器基于虚拟化技术(如KVM、Xen)运行,其硬件抽象层对操作系统安装有特殊要求。例如,Linux系统内核需支持"virtio"驱动才能在云平台中高效运行存储和网络设备,而Windows Server 2019及以上版本对Hyper-V的兼容需额外配置。教学中,我曾让学员对比CentOS 7与CentOS Stream在云服务器中的启动差异,发现多数学员因未理解"内核版本与硬件驱动匹配"原理,在迁移时出现"内核panic"错误。这暴露了教学中对"虚拟化驱动"和"硬件抽象层"知识点的讲解不足,学员仅掌握"下载镜像-上传-启动"的流程,却无法解释"为何不同镜像启动时间差异达2-3分钟"的现象。 **2. 网络环境与系统访问的场景化缺失** 云服务器的网络配置(私有网络VPC、安全组、弹性IP)直接影响系统安装后的远程访问。教学中常见学员因以下问题失败: - **子网掩码配置错误**:如在192.168.1.0/24网段内设置网关192.168.1.254,导致与云服务商提供的默认网关冲突; - **安全组规则未开放关键端口**:如安装Windows Server后未开放3389端口,导致无法通过RDP远程连接; - **DNS解析异常**:Linux系统中误将云服务商提供的私有DNS(如阿里云100.100.2.136)配置为8.8.8.8,导致yum源无法访问。 这些问题反映出教学中"理论讲解与实操脱节":学员在本地局域网中测试系统时无需配置复杂网络,而云环境的网络隔离性(如私有子网与公网的访问限制)被忽视。 **3. 数据迁移与系统升级的持续性教学缺失** 实际场景中,云服务器安装常伴随系统迁移(从本地服务器或旧云服务器迁移)或版本升级(如从CentOS 7迁移至CentOS Stream 9),而教学中往往只关注"从零开始安装",忽略这两个关键环节: - **数据迁移工具选择**:学员在迁移MySQL数据库时,直接将本地SQL文件上传至云服务器,却未考虑云存储与本地存储的格式差异(如NTFS与ext4的兼容性); - **系统升级风险控制**:对Ubuntu 20.04 LTS系统执行"do-release-upgrade"时,因未提前备份/回滚环境,导致依赖库冲突。 这些问题的教学痛点在于"静态步骤教学"与"动态运维场景"的割裂,学员缺乏对系统全生命周期管理的理解。 #### 四、教学优化方案:构建"原理+场景+工具"的立体化教学体系 针对上述问题,教学反思后提出以下优化方案,从三个维度重构教学内容: **1. 底层原理可视化:用"三维模型"拆解系统安装** - **硬件层**:通过对比"物理服务器-虚拟机-云服务器"的硬件抽象层级,理解云服务器的"共享计算资源+虚拟化隔离"特性; - **镜像层**:制作"镜像选择决策树",引导学员根据应用场景选择操作系统(如:Web服务选CentOS 8 Stream,数据库服务选PostgreSQL+Ubuntu 22.04); - **网络层**:搭建"云网络沙箱",模拟不同VPC环境(如公网访问、私有子网、混合云)下的系统访问路径,直观展示安全组规则对端口访问的控制。 **2. 场景化实操:从"单一任务"到"业务闭环"** 设计三类典型场景,覆盖学员常见需求: - **基础Web应用场景**:使用阿里云ECS安装CentOS 8,配置Nginx+MySQL+PHP环境,同时实践"最小权限原则"(非root用户运行Web服务); - **Windows Server迁移场景**:对比本地Windows Server 2019与阿里云Windows Server 2019镜像的差异,演示"通过镜像共享实现数据迁移"; - **混合云灾备场景**:模拟在腾讯云服务器上安装CentOS 7,通过快照功能实现与华为云服务器的系统数据同步。 每个场景配套"问题清单",如"Web服务无法启动的排查步骤"(检查防火墙、SELinux状态、服务日志),帮助学员建立自主解决问题的能力。 **3. 工具赋能:引入自动化运维工具降低学习门槛** - **Terraform+Ansible**:演示通过代码实现云服务器操作系统的自动化安装与配置(如使用Terraform定义云服务器规格、Ansible批量执行yum install命令); - **Docker容器化部署**:对比"传统云服务器安装系统+应用"与"云服务器安装Docker+容器化应用"的效率差异,让学员理解云原生趋势下的系统管理新范式; - **监控工具集成**:在安装后部署Prometheus+Grafana,监控系统资源使用率、服务健康状态,培养学员的运维思维。 #### 五、长期价值延伸:超越"安装",构建云时代系统管理能力 云服务器操作系统的教学不应止步于"安装成功",而应延伸至系统全生命周期管理: - **安全加固实践**:讲解"操作系统基线配置"(如禁用不必要服务、限制SSH登录IP、定期更新补丁),通过漏洞扫描工具(如Nessus)检测安装后系统的安全风险; - **性能优化技巧**:针对Linux系统的"内存分配策略""内核参数调优"(如vm.swappiness=10),Windows Server的"磁盘IO优化""CPU缓存设置"进行实操训练; - **容灾与迁移能力**:通过"系统快照-跨区域复制-回滚测试"流程,让学员掌握云服务器数据备份与系统迁移的最佳实践。 教学中还需强化"云服务商生态差异"的对比,如阿里云的"镜像市场""快照服务",腾讯云的"云监控告警",帮助学员适应不同平台的管理逻辑。 #### 六、结语:教学反思是技术迭代的持续动力 云服务器安装操作系统的教学反思,本质是对"技术教学如何适应云时代发展"的探索。从最初的"步骤罗列"到如今的"原理+场景+工具",教学目标已从"让学员学会操作"升级为"让学员具备系统思维与运维能力"。未来教学中,还需持续关注云原生技术(如Kubernetes集群管理)对操作系统的新要求,将"容器化部署""Serverless架构"等前沿内容融入教学,让学员真正成为适应云计算发展的复合型技术人才。

登录账户-联系专属客服咨询业务

只需完成账户认证,即可免费体验塔妖性能优化、ICP备案管家服务、云服务器等多款安全产品

© Copyright 2015 - 2024 | TaYao All rights reserved

增值电信经营许可证:B1.B2-20240117 工信部备案号: 津ICP备2024020432号-2本站支持IPv6访问